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ions QEMU (affected versions not specified)
Description The issue is related to a memory leak in the virgl resource attach backing function, which can be exploited by a local guest OS user to cause a denial of service through host memory consumption. This can be achieved by sending a large number of VIRTIO GPU CMD RESOURCE ATTACH BACKING commands.
Recommendations At the moment, there is no information about a newer version that contains a fix for this vulnerability.
